Best Blu-ray you can see: Planet Earth. 300 was crap, they added extra grain for the feel of the movie and in the end the DVD was better than the Blu-ray. The Dark Knight was good, especially in shots of the city. Iron man was awesome, lots of detail everywhere. Cars is very good on Blu-ray, you can see bits of rubber and whatnot getting thrown around on the track. Also they did a really good job putting Office Space on Blu-ray, watched the DVD and Blu-ray side by side one night when I was bored.
